Do you drive in snow?
If not, and if it were my decision to make, I'd get the BFG Advantage TA, the Michelin Harmony, or the Kumho Platinum. Pretty much any T or H rated touring tire... in tire rack lingo that would be a "Highway all season" or a "touring all season/grand touring all season" tire. Most Michelins will be out of your price range, but the Harmonys aren't that expensive.
Sams isn't really much cheaper than Tire rack, but as long as you keep your membership up you get the "free" warranty, which I have used and it is fantastic. If you do spend a lot of time on dirt roads or construction areas or whatever, that will likely pay for a patch/plug or new tire in the life of the four you buy. The tire rack warranty is useless, per my "tire rack certified price" installer. The sams is good in my experience, and available everywhere, and no hassle of getting reimbursed.
